Town Announces ‘One Last Summer Blast’ Concert with Lords of 52nd Street
Oyster Bay Town Supervisor Joseph Saladino today announced that the Lords of 52nd Street will play ‘one last summer blast’ drive-in concert at TOBAY Beach on Saturday, September 12th at 7:00 p.m.  This free concert will offer Town residents one last chance to soak up summertime fun before the fall season arrives. The Lords of 52nd Street features the legends of The Billy Joel Band, including Richie Cannata, Liberty DeVitto, and Russell Javors. 
 
Supervisor Saladino stated, “The Lords of 52nd Street are legends of rock n’ roll and put on an amazing performance each time out, recreating all of Billy Joel’s indelible hits that they were originally a part of. The Town is proud to present this free drive-in concert to residents.”
 
Vehicles will be admitted to the parking lot on a first-come, first-served basis beginning at 6:00 p.m. the day of the event.  For the safety of all residents, concertgoers must remain in their cars. Portable restroom facilities will be on-site.
